Insulating a building is crucial for maintaining a comfortable indoor environment and reducing energy consumption. In traditional construction, insulation materials such as fiberglass, foam board, and mineral wool have been commonly used. While these materials are effective at reducing heat transfer, they often come with environmental drawbacks. Fiberglass insulation, for example, is made from glass fibers that can cause skin irritation and respiratory issues if not handled properly. Foam board insulation is typically made from petrochemicals, which are non-renewable resources that contribute to greenhouse gas emissions.

green building insulation materials offer a more sustainable alternative. These materials are made from renewable or recycled resources and are free from harmful chemicals. One popular option is cellulose insulation, which is made from recycled paper products treated with borate compounds to make them resistant to pests and mold. Cellulose insulation is not only environmentally friendly but also provides excellent thermal performance, making it a cost-effective choice for green buildings.

Another common green building insulation material is recycled denim or cotton insulation. This material is made from recycled denim jeans or cotton scraps and offers similar thermal performance to traditional insulation materials. Recycled denim insulation is free from harmful chemicals and is easy to install, making it a popular choice for green builders looking to reduce their environmental impact.

In addition to recycled and renewable materials, green building insulation materials also include natural fibers such as wool, hemp, and cork. These materials are biodegradable, non-toxic, and have excellent insulating properties. Wool insulation, for example, is naturally fire-resistant and has moisture-wicking properties that help regulate indoor humidity levels. Hemp insulation is a durable and sustainable option that can help reduce the carbon footprint of a building, while cork insulation is known for its acoustic insulation properties and ability to absorb indoor pollutants.

green building insulation materials not only offer environmental benefits but also contribute to improved indoor air quality. Traditional insulation materials can release volatile organic compounds (VOCs) and other harmful chemicals into the air, leading to poor indoor air quality and potential health risks for occupants. Green building insulation materials are free from VOCs and other harmful chemicals, creating a healthier indoor environment for building occupants.

In addition to environmental and health benefits, green building insulation materials can also help reduce energy consumption and lower utility bills. By improving the thermal performance of a building, green insulation materials can help maintain a consistent indoor temperature and reduce the need for heating and cooling systems. This leads to lower energy consumption and reduced greenhouse gas emissions, making green buildings more sustainable in the long run.

When choosing green building insulation materials, it is important to consider factors such as thermal performance, moisture resistance, fire resistance, and environmental impact. Builders and designers should also consider the life cycle assessment of insulation materials, including their production, transportation, installation, and disposal.
